LOCALDNS择优策略

阅读: 评论:0

LOCALDNS择优策略

LOCALDNS择优策略

eg:域名www.a存在4个NS,下面说下localdns如何对4个NS进行择优解析
采用SRTT 的初始化及更新方法
a) 初始化A B C D四个NS的SRTT分别为1-4us
b) 选择SRTT最小的一个NS服务器A发起解析请求。
c) 被选择的NS服务器的SRTT进行更新:SRTT = ( oldSRTT / 10 * 7 ) + ( RTT / 10 * 3)。
d) 未被选中的NS服务器SRTT进行衰减:SRTT = ((SRTT<<9)-SRTT)>>9;
e) 惩罚措施。当向被选中的NS服务器发起解析请求时,如果由于网络超时、丢包、服务器特别慢或者其他原因,没有得到该NS服务器的响应包,那么LOCALDNS在其他的NS服务器当中继续选择SRTT最小的一个服务器发起解析请求,LOCALDNS还要对没有返回响应包的NS服务器的SRTT施加一个惩罚:
f) 经过4次解析可以确认A B C D中最优NS,localdns会在1800s后对SRTT的值都重新初始化一次

本文发布于:2024-02-04 09:44:12,感谢您对本站的认可!

本文链接:https://www.4u4v.net/it/170704360454471.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:策略   LOCALDNS
留言与评论(共有 0 条评论)
   
验证码:

Copyright ©2019-2022 Comsenz Inc.Powered by ©

网站地图1 网站地图2 网站地图3 网站地图4 网站地图5 网站地图6 网站地图7 网站地图8 网站地图9 网站地图10 网站地图11 网站地图12 网站地图13 网站地图14 网站地图15 网站地图16 网站地图17 网站地图18 网站地图19 网站地图20 网站地图21 网站地图22/a> 网站地图23